Srinagar, April 20 : Police on Monday said it has arrested two militant associates of Jaish-e-Mohammad militant outfit in southern region of Kashmir.
An official told Kashmir Despatch, on specific input about the movement of two militant associates of JeM outfit who were planning to attack on security force deployment, Shopian police laid a naka near Wachi petrol pump, while observing naka two suspects tried to flee from spot but deployed joint team of Army’s 55 RR, CRPF 178 bn, Jammu and Kashmir Police Shopian overpowered both the suspects and were detained.
Officer said a pistol, two grenades were recovered from their possession.
During interrogation duo accused claimed themselves as associates of Jaish-e-Mohammad militant outfit and were proved arms and ammunition recently.
Officer said in this regard a case FIR number. 27/2020 of PS Zainpora U/S 18, 20, 23,38, 39 ula p act, 7/25 IAA stands registered and further investigation has been initiated officer added
